Yellow mount with images of the town of Amherst’s Civil War Soldiers’ monument. Images are light but clear. Unknown photographer. Pen & ink inscription on reverse lists all soldier’s names and regiments that are on monument as well as the comment “Dr. Aiken’s house behind the monument on the left, Amherst, N.H.”  Card is in good condition overall.  [jet][PH:L]
